Key Responsibilities:
- Provide hands-on support and troubleshooting for hardware, software, and network issues at various client locations. This includes setting up desktops, laptops, printers, peripherals, POS systems, and networking equipment.
- Deploy and configure hardware and software systems, ensuring compatibility, security, and optimal performance.
- Analyze and diagnose technical issues, identify root causes, and implement effective solutions in a timely manner to minimize downtime and disruption.
- Perform routine maintenance tasks, system updates, and security patches to proactively address potential issues and maintain system integrity.
- Maintain accurate records of support activities, including ticket management, troubleshooting steps, resolutions, and system configurations. Generate reports to track trends, identify recurring issues, and propose long-term solutions.
- Provide user training and guidance on software applications, system functionality, and best practices to enhance productivity and minimize user errors.
- CCTV- Deploy and install surveillance systems to ensure optimal performance
- Adding new user accounts, modifying permissions, removing accounts in O365, Azure, SharePoint, etc.
- Testing new technology and solutions (purchasing, building, installing, etc.)
- Training staff on technology use, including new computers, printers, and software
- Traveling to company locations to assist with IT service installation, repair, or general support.
- Monitoring and maintaining computer systems and networks which includes upgrading anti-virus software and security systems to ensure network security.
- Maintaining technical documentation of all IT related work
- Responding in a timely manner to service issues and requests
- Perform light mechanical work on arcade equipment (e.g., adjusting motors, tightening belts, replacing minor mechanical components)
Qualifications:
- Previous IT experience related to CCTV, POS, Firewall, Switching, WiFi, Microsoft O365, Windows OS, HyperV, VoIP Phones, DMX Lighting, Audio, Door access control, TV, PC peripherals
- Minimum of two years of experience in IT support, with a focus on field support and on-site troubleshooting.
- Experience with software installation - Windows OS, RMM, Drivers, Embed, Brunswick Sync, Aloha.
- Previous troubleshooting experience in diagnosing and resolving hardware, software, and network issues across multiple platforms, including Windows, macOS, and Linux.
- Working in a team environment
- Provide discretion and confidentiality
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to effectively interact with users of varying technical levels in a professional and courteous manner.
- Detail-oriented with strong organizational and time management skills with the 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ment.
- Must be self-motivated and proactive in completing duties and working on projects.
- Ability to climb ladders and work comfortable with heights required.
- Valid driver's license and willingness to travel to client sites as needed.
